One Good Woman
Abby Knox

Buckley Elliot is a down-on-his-luck wounded veteran who plans on voting for the other guy. He doesn’t trust that goody-goody Daphne Featherstone as far as he can throw her. When he overhears a plot to set her up, he positions himself as the man for the job. As soon as he meets her, however, he finds himself ready to stuff her ballot box… and stuff it FULL. Or, if nothing else, ready to make her the perfect morning-after omelette.
